    Understanding the Core Difference

    Vtiger is Vtiger is an all-in-one AI CRM covering sales, marketing, help desk, projects and inventory in one platform. Licences come in a Standard User tier with full access to every app and a cheaper Single App User tier with write access to one app and read-only access to the rest.

    Zeliq is Sales prospecting and engagement platform that combines a lead search and waterfall enrichment hub with multichannel sequences across email, calls and social, plus a connected dialer and CRM sync.

    Vtiger Pricing (as of September 2026)

    PlanPrice
    One Growth$15/mo
    One Professional$42/mo
    One Enterprise$58/mo
    One AI$66/mo
    One PilotFree

    Source: Vtiger Pricing

    Zeliq Pricing (as of September 2026)

    PlanPriceContactsEmails
    BasicFreeImport up to 100 leads per monthRun 2 active sequences (emails only)
    Starter$59/mo750 credits / month75 phone numbers or 750 emails
    CustomContact SalesStarts as from 24k credits/user/year-

    Source: Zeliq Pricing

    Integration Ecosystem

    Vtiger Integrations

    Vtiger connects with: Gmail, Google Workspace, Microsoft Outlook, Office 365, Microsoft Teams, WhatsApp, Zapier, Mailchimp, QuickBooks, Xero.

    Zeliq Integrations

    Zeliq connects with: HubSpot, Salesforce, Pipedrive, Aircall, Ringover, Gmail, Microsoft, API.
